Get A Taste Of Some of the Attractions of Washington DC

Washington DC is well known for many historic and education attractions, such as museums, memorials, and galleries. These attractions can be both fun and informative for individuals and even families. One interesting museum worth visiting is the National Building Museum. This museum deals with the architecture and its many innovations.

Another  spectacular attraction in Washington DC is the Korean War Memorial. This memorial was in commemoration of those who lost their lives and fought in the Korean War.  Washington DC is an extra special vacation destination since it  is home to the United States Capitol.   Your Washington DC vacation would not be complete without visiting the Capitol.  It is considered to be one of the most architecturally beautiful buildings in the world.  Tours are also available inside the capitol.

Visit The Home Of The President Of The United States

Make sure to get a close up view of the White House while in CD too.  The White House is also one of the most popular attractions in all of Washington DC’s tourism industry. This is the house where the President of the United States and his family lives.  You can take a tour which may include a look inside the home of the president.  Just imagine how exciting a tour of the white house could be.

Next, be sure to pass by the Washington Monument.  This monument stands as a symbol for George Washington and the hard work for America.  The Washington monument is 5555/8 ft. tall and is visible from up to 40 miles away in clear weather. Another extremely popular attraction in Washington DC’s tourism industry is the Smithsonian. This incredibly large museum is a great collection of a variety of items. This museum is a must-see for any Washington DC tourist.

Keeping Younger Children Busy & Entertained

Younger kids won't be bored in Washington DC.  There are many attractions for smaller, younger children.  For example, the National Zoo is a great place to take young kids where they can enjoy themselves. The National Zoo is part of the Smithsonian and houses 2,000 individual animals and nearly 400 different species of animals. The National Zoo is best known for the endangered giant pandas, they are Tian Tian, Mei Xiang, and their cub, Tai Shan.

Another great activity for families with younger children is the National Aquarium. Visiting this attraction can be a day long activity.  It  has over 50 different tanks, 1000 different specimens, and nearly 200 different species.   That should be enough to keep your younger kids entertained all day long.  Make sure you take the kids to meet the two alligators at the aquarium known as Crunch and Munch.
